Transaction 18e39150467118dd14c94377ccb248a8e6f5f95ef2dcacb1c6c8afd8889fe076
1 Input
1 Output
-
18e39150467118dd14c94377ccb248a8e6f5f95ef2dcacb1c6c8afd8889fe076:0
- value
- 77121088
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0f368a49556454f0d07fe1ab4deb011a3891e17
- address
- bc1qkrek3fy42ez57rg8lcdtfh4szx3cj8shj6mhs9